The humid, subtropical climate and occasional flooding in Atlanta, LA, can accelerate corrosion and electrical issues. Common repairs for Toyotas here include brake rotor corrosion, failing alternators due to moisture, and air conditioning system strain from constant use.
Look for shops with ASE-certified technicians, especially those with Toyota-specific training (T-TEN). Check reviews for local shops like Atlanta Automotive or seek recommendations from the nearby Natchitoches community, as specialized service can be limited in smaller towns.
Labor rates may be slightly lower than in major metros, but parts availability can sometimes cause delays or increased costs for less common components. It's wise to get written estimates from local shops, as pricing for diagnostics and labor can vary.
For complex hybrid system issues or warranty work, the nearest Toyota dealerships are in Shreveport or Alexandria. For most routine maintenance, recalls, and common repairs, a trusted local independent shop in Atlanta can provide quality, convenient service.
The mix of rural highways, unpaved roads, and seasonal heavy rainfall means you should prioritize tire inspections, undercarriage checks for rust, and more frequent cabin air filter changes to handle pollen and dust. This proactive maintenance helps prevent larger repairs.
